Pop culture, chaos theory, and matters of the heart collide in this unique novella from the Hugo and Nebula Award–winning author of Doomsday Book.
Sandra Foster studies fads—from Barbie dolls to the grunge look—how they start and what they mean, for the HiTek corporation. Bennett O'Reilly studies monkey-group behavior and chaos theory for the same company. When the two are thrust together due to a misdelivered package and a run of seemingly bad luck, they find a joint project in a flock of sheep. What better animal to study both chaos theory and the herd mentality that so often characterizes human behavior? Unfortunately, Sandra and Bennett must endure a series of setbacks, heartbreaks, dead ends, and disasters before they are able to find answers to their questions—with the unintended help of the errant, forgetful, and careless office assistant Flip.
